Description
Christopher M. Woodhouse was twenty-two years old when World War II broke out. He was enlisted in the Royal Artillery of Britain in October 1939 and reached the rank of colonel by 1944. He arrived in Greece for the first time as an officer of the British Military Mission and participated in the operations that took place until the evacuation of Crete in the spring of 1941. From Crete, he left with his commander, Lieutenant Colonel Eddie Myers, for mainland Greece. On November 25, 1942, together with members of the British Military Mission and men from Aris Velouchiotis and Napoleon Zervas, they blew up the Gorgopotamos Bridge, an action considered one of the most significant resistance acts of World War II.
Woodhouse, as a connoisseur of Greek affairs, had extensive activity in Greece, coming into contact with many of the key players and forming a firsthand opinion on the events and critical incidents that marked the country's history. In 1948, while the civil war was raging, he published his book "The Apple of Discord" in English, which has since become a reference point. Seven decades later, the book remains extremely interesting. From the regime of August 4th, the heroic epic of Albania, the German occupation, the resistance organizations, and the Conference of Lebanon, to the liberation, the December events, and everything that led to the bloody civil war, the author describes in detail the critical events for Greece of a tumultuous decade, the consequences of which we still observe today.
